Fluticasone propionate is a corticosteroid commonly used as a nasal spray or inhaler for conditions like Asthma and allergic rhinitis. Dizziness is not a common side effect of fluticasone propionate, but some individuals may experience it as a rare reaction. If you notice persistent dizziness after using the medication, it's important to consult your healthcare provider for further evaluation.
